I've been getting this with more frequency in Entourage X. Rebuidling
the database always clears things up, but it seems that I have to
rebuild more often.

My database is a 2.25GB in size, running os 10.4.5 on a 17" powerbook.

I've rebuilt permissions and all of the other voodoo suggested in
online FAQs. I'm concerned that the program seems to be getting less
reliable.

Sometimes this error indicates a problem Entourage is having with the
Microsoft Database Daemon. Quit the daemon. Then go to System
preferences/Startup Items and remove any entries of the database daemon from
the 'login items' window. Now start up Entourage again and hopefully the
problem will have been resolved.
